APPLICATION OF THE IMPACT-ECHO DIAGNOSTIC METHOD FOR THE DETECTION OF LARGE CAVITIES IN THICK-WALLED CONCRETE STRUCTURES OF NUCLEAR POWER PLANTS


Abstract eng:
The methods, how to do in-service inspections of ageing reinforced concrete of nuclear power plants more quickly, cheaply and reliably, are still looking for. Advanced Impact-Echo method seams to be very hopeful. It consists in the locating void position by the reflections of elastic waves between the void and surface. This paper continues a set of previous works. The numerical simulations of the fast transient processes for the detection and localization of cavities in the different positions are presented here. The second way - the detection in frequency domain exactly according to ASTM - will be demonstrated in second part of the paper.
